Handover note — Crumbwheel order cutoffs.

Welcome aboard. The bakery cutoff rule in Crumbwheel closes same-day orders at 14:00 local to each storefront, not UTC — this has bitten us twice. Holiday overrides live in the calendar service and take precedence silently, so always check there first when a cutoff looks wrong. To unlock the calendar service's admin console after a restart, enter the recovery passphrase below.

vault phrase of bagap-bahaf = silion-pelox-sorox-casdor-quenwyn-fraax-eliox-praael-kelion-quenvan-kasox-rusael-norius-belvan

Subject: Key rotation for the Quillrender service

Hi support team,

As part of last week's work on template rendering performance, we moved Quillrender onto the new caching tier, and that migration requires rotating its service credentials. The old key stops working Friday evening. Macros, canned responses, and the preview pane in Helmdesk will all switch over automatically, but if you run local tooling against Quillrender, please update your configuration. Use the replacement key below.

service key, yadug-bajog: zpat3_pou

Markdown pipeline runbook — Ferngate renderer. If preview output is blank, check the Slateroot sanitizer stage first; it silently drops documents over 2MB. Restart the worker pool, then replay the failed queue from the Mirrowell dashboard. Do not clear the cache unless rendering errors persist after replay. Escalate to the Ferngate on-call if replay loops twice. Verification requires the trace token from the last successful replay, shown below.

trace token, yahif-kagep: htk31_bd0cc6b1d7ab4f7094c586a5de900e0

Handover Note — Billing Transition. Welcome, and apologies for the compressed timeline. The move to annual billing for Larkspan Suite customers is roughly 60% complete. Migration scripts are stable, but the retention team in Ombersley needs closer oversight — discount requests are drifting above policy. Finance has modelled cash-flow impact through Q3; review their assumptions carefully. The confidential direction from the board appears below.

management briefing: Project Ulavan slips by two quarters because of the staffing delay.